diaper verb trans. LME.
[from DIAPER noun & adjective: cf. Old & mod. French diaprer, diapre diapered.]
I.
Decorate with a small uniform pattern, esp. of diamonds. LME.
Adorn with diversely coloured details; variegate. L16.
II.
Change the nappy of (a baby). N. Amer. M20.
diapering noun (a) the action of the verb; (b) diapered decoration or patterns: LME.
